Limiting the Data

The Limit Data By options determine how the data analyzed from the VHS is displayed.

Limit Data By

Points that meet the minimum criteria for the limits selected are listed individually with their corresponding statistics. Points that don’t meet these criteria will be summed together and shown as a single row labeled **Sum of minor points (n). The limit options can be used individually or in combination. They are cumulative and only points that meet all the enabled requirements will be displayed individually.

If no limits are set, each point will have its own entry and the **Sum of minor points (n) row will be empty. In essence, this is a copy of the VHS, and is an ineffective way to view and manage large amounts of VHS data. It is strongly recommended that the limit options be used in a meaningful way to increase the speed of the analysis and limit the amount of data viewed on the screen.

Limit Type Description

Entry Count >

Includes only those points that have more VHS entries than the specified number.

Daily Avg >

Includes only those points that have a higher average of new VHS entries per day than the value specified.

Potential >

Includes only those points that would have more VHS entries than the value specified if that point was at its steady state.

Active Points Only

Includes only active points in display.

Click Refresh to refresh statistics after changing a limit filter.
